Document background
The Property License Agreement (Licence Agreement Property) is essential for situations where full property ownership or traditional lease arrangements are not necessary or desired. This document, governed by Danish law, is commonly used when one party needs to grant another party specific rights to use or access a property for a defined purpose and period. It's particularly useful for temporary arrangements, specific-use cases, or when flexibility is required beyond traditional property agreements. The document includes detailed terms about property usage rights, restrictions, fees, maintenance responsibilities, and compliance with Danish property regulations. It's designed to protect both the property owner's interests and the licensee's rights while ensuring adherence to Danish legal requirements for property usage and registration. This type of agreement is increasingly relevant in modern business contexts where flexible property arrangements are needed.
Suggested Sections

1. Parties: Identification of the Licensor and Licensee with full legal names, registration numbers (if applicable), and addresses

2. Background: Context of the agreement, brief description of the property, and the parties' intentions

3. Definitions: Definitions of key terms used throughout the agreement, including 'Property', 'License Period', 'Permitted Use', etc.

4. Grant of License: Specific rights being granted, scope of the license, and any restrictions on use

5. License Period: Duration of the license, including start date, end date, and any renewal provisions

6. License Fee: Amount, payment terms, payment method, and timing of license fee payments

7. Permitted Use: Detailed description of how the Licensee may use the property and any restrictions

8. Licensee Obligations: Key responsibilities of the Licensee including maintenance, compliance with laws, etc.

9. Licensor Obligations: Key responsibilities of the Licensor including access, maintenance of structure, etc.

10. Insurance: Required insurance coverage and responsibilities for maintaining insurance

11. Termination: Circumstances under which the agreement can be terminated and the process for termination

12. Liability and Indemnity: Allocation of risks and responsibilities between parties

13.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Confirmation of Danish law as governing law and jurisdiction for disputes

14. Notices: Process and addresses for formal communications between parties

Optional Sections

1. Security Deposit: Terms for any security deposit required, typically used for higher-value properties or where there's significant risk

2. Utilities and Services: Include when the license includes responsibility for utilities or shared services

3. Alterations: Include when the Licensee may need to make changes to the property

4. Assignment and Sublicensing: Include when transfer of rights needs to be explicitly addressed

5. Force Majeure: Include for longer-term licenses or where external factors could significantly impact the agreement

6. Environmental Matters: Include for properties where environmental compliance is a significant concern

7. Planning and Zoning: Include when specific use restrictions or planning requirements need to be addressed

8. Data Protection: Include when personal data processing is involved in the agreement

Suggested Schedules

1. Property Description: Detailed description of the licensed property including plans, photographs, and boundaries

2. License Fee Schedule: Detailed breakdown of fees, payment dates, and calculation methods if variable

3. Condition Report: Documentation of property condition at the start of the license period

4. Permitted Use Details: Detailed specifications of allowed activities and any restrictions

5. Insurance Requirements: Specific insurance requirements including types of coverage and minimum amounts

6. Building Rules and Regulations: Any applicable building rules or regulations that the Licensee must follow

7. Service Level Agreement: If applicable, details of any services provided as part of the license

8. Required Permits and Certificates: Copies of relevant permits, certificates, or authorizations
